Warning Signs You Need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ration

Catching the signs of water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Is there a persistent musty smell in your rental units, even after you’ve cleaned and disinfected? This could be a sign of mold and mildew growth, which can be hazardous to your tenants’ health.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Are your floors showing signs of warping or buckling? This could be a sign that water has seeped into the subfloor and is causing damage to the flooring.

Stained or Discolored Walls

Are there water stains or discoloration on your walls? This could be a sign that water has seeped into the walls and is causing damage to the drywall or plaster.

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ration Cost in Crosby, TX

The cost of multi-family water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Crosby, TX. Here’s a rough estimate of what you can exp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Structural dr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of property, extent of damage
Sanitizing and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Type of equipment needed, size of affected area
Final inspection and cleaning $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
More repairs or replacements $1,000 – $10,000 Type of repairs or replacements needed, size of affected area
